Animal Crossing’s Easter celebration is well underway in New Horizons as of April 1, with Zipper spearheading the Bunny Day event. Here’s everything you need to know about it.

For the first time in a mainline entry in the series, holiday events span over several days rather than just one. For Easter, Zipper T. Bunny has scattered multiple types of eggs and crafting recipes all around your island, and has tasked you to search for them and make themed furniture and items before April 12.

It’s not as cut and dry as just finding them though – particular eggs require different methods, and you’ll need to seek out the recipes in order to craft certain items. Luckily for you, we’ve got everything you need to know on how to complete his Bunny Day challenge.

Where to find eggs

There isn’t just one set type – there’s actually six kinds you’ll have to discover if you want to craft all the DIYs: Water, Earth, Leaf, Wood, Stone, and Sky. They can be found by:

Water – Using your rod to fish in the river and the ocean

Earth – Digging at star-shaped holes with your shovel

Leaf – Shaking trees

Wood – Chopping trees with your axe

Stone – Hitting rocks with your shovel

Sky – Using your slingshot to pop present balloons out of the sky

When fishing, the eggs will be medium-sized shapes in the water, so look out for those to maximize your chances of finding them. As for chopping trees, make sure you use a flimsy axe to get three chops without cutting the tree down, and when smashing rocks, dig three holes behind you in order to get all eight hits.

How to get crafting recipes

Like regular recipes, the Easter ones are random – though Zipper will give you the Bunny Day Bed when you first talk to him, and the Arch on April 12. You can find them by either shooting down striped balloons with your slingshot, picking up striped bottles from the beach, or talking to your fellow villagers.

You’ll also automatically learn some clothing recipes like the Earth-Egg Outfit and the Leaf-Egg Shell after you’ve gathered a certain number of each egg type, so keep collecting them until your character says they’ve imagined a new way to use them.

After you’ve crafted everything, the rabbit will gift you with the recipe for the Wobbling Zipper Toy. If you show him this once you’ve made it, he’ll give you the one for the Bunny Day Wand.

Every crafting recipe as well as what eggs you need to make the items can be found below:

Bunny Day Bed – 1x Stone, 1x Earth, 1x Leaf, 1x Wood, 1x Sky, 1x Water

Wall Clock – 3x Sky

Lamp – 4x Wood

Vanity – 4x Leaf

Glowy Garland – 1x Earth, 1x Stone, 1x Leaf, 1x Wood, 1x Sky, 1x Water

Stool – 3x Water

Wardrobe – 4x Stone

Wreath – 1x Stone, 1x Earth, 1x Leaf, 1x Wood, 1x Sky, 1x Water

Table – 4x Earth

Bag – 1x Stone, 1x Earth, 1x Leaf, 1x Wood, 1x Sky, 1x Water

Crown – 1x Stone, 1x Earth, 1x Leaf, 1x Wood, 1x Sky, 1x Water

Wallpaper – 2x Stone, 2x Earth, 2x Leaf, 2x Wood, 2x Sky, 2x Water

Flooring – 2x Stone, 2x Earth, 2x Leaf, 2x Wood, 2x Sky, 2x Water

Fence – 1x Stone, 1x Earth, 1x Leaf, 1x Wood, 1x Sky, 1x Water

Merry Balloons – 1x Earth, 1x Leaf, 1x Sky

Festive Balloons – 1x Stone, 1x Wood, 1x Water

Rug – 1x Stone, 1x Earth, 1x Leaf, 1x Wood, 1x Sky, 1x Water

Arch – 2x Stone, 2x Earth, 2x Leaf, 2x Wood, 2x Sky, 2x Water

Earth-Egg Shell – 2x Earth

Earth-Egg Outfit – 3x Earth

Earth-Egg Shoes – 2x Earth

Stone-Egg Shell – 2x Stone

Stone-Egg Outfit – 3x Stone

Stone-Egg Shoes – 2x Stone

Leaf-Egg Shell – 2x Leaf

Leaf-Egg Outfit – 3x Leaf

Leaf-Egg Shoes – 2x Leaf

Wood-Egg Shell – 2x Wood

Wood-Egg Outfit – 3x Wood

Wood-Egg Shoes – 2x Wood

Sky-Egg Shell – 2x Sky

Sky-Egg Outfit – 3x Sky

Sky-Egg Shoes – 2x Sky

Water-Egg Shell – 2x Water

Water-Egg Outfit – 3x Water

Water-Egg Shoes – 2x Water

Party Hat – 2x Stone, 2x Earth, 2x Leaf, 2x Wood, 2x Sky, 2x Water

Party Dress – 3x Stone, 3x Earth, 3x Leaf, 3x Wood, 3x Sky, 3x Water
